2025-02-07 03:00:30 +00:00
|
|
|
|
C51 COMPILER V9.01 BOOTAPP 02/07/2025 10:36:16 PAGE 1
|
2025-02-06 07:35:32 +00:00
|
|
|
|
|
|
|
|
|
|
|
|
|
|
C51 COMPILER V9.01, COMPILATION OF MODULE BOOTAPP
|
|
|
|
|
OBJECT MODULE PLACED IN .\output\BootApp.obj
|
|
|
|
|
COMPILER INVOKED BY: D:\Tool\Keil\C51\BIN\C51.EXE code_drv\BootApp.c LARGE OPTIMIZE(7,SIZE) REGFILE(.\output\MCUCore_Loa
|
|
|
|
|
-d.ORC) BROWSE INTVECTOR(0X1000) INCDIR(.\header_app;.\header_drv;.\code_gasguage;.\code_classb\iec60730_lib\include;.\co
|
|
|
|
|
-de_classb\iec60730_proc\Include;.\code_classb\config) DEBUG OBJECTEXTEND PRINT(.\output\BootApp.lst) OBJECT(.\output\Boo
|
|
|
|
|
-tApp.obj)
|
|
|
|
|
|
|
|
|
|
line level source
|
|
|
|
|
|
|
|
|
|
1 /********************************************************************************
|
|
|
|
|
2 Copyright (C), Sinowealth Electronic. Ltd.
|
|
|
|
|
3 Author: sino
|
|
|
|
|
4 Version: V1.0
|
|
|
|
|
5 Date: 2020/12/29
|
|
|
|
|
6 History:
|
|
|
|
|
7 V0.0 2020/04/26 Preliminary
|
|
|
|
|
8 ********************************************************************************/
|
|
|
|
|
9 #include "Main.h"
|
|
|
|
|
10
|
|
|
|
|
11 /*************************************************************************************************
|
|
|
|
|
12 * <20><><EFBFBD><EFBFBD><EFBFBD><EFBFBD>: ISPProcess
|
|
|
|
|
13 * <20><> <20><>: <20><>
|
|
|
|
|
14 * <20><><EFBFBD><EFBFBD>ֵ: <20><>
|
|
|
|
|
15 * <20><> <20><>: ISP<53><50>IAP<41>Ľӿں<D3BF><DABA><EFBFBD>
|
|
|
|
|
16 *************************************************************************************************/
|
|
|
|
|
17 void ISPProcess(void)
|
|
|
|
|
18 {
|
|
|
|
|
19 1 if(bISPFlg &&( bUart0SndAckFlg ||bUart1SndAckFlg||bUart2SndAckFlg))
|
|
|
|
|
20 1 {
|
|
|
|
|
21 2 bISPFlg = 0;
|
|
|
|
|
22 2 bUart0SndAckFlg = 0;
|
|
|
|
|
23 2 bUart1SndAckFlg = 0;
|
|
|
|
|
24 2 bUart2SndAckFlg = 0;
|
|
|
|
|
25 2 IrqDis(); //<2F>ر<EFBFBD><D8B1><EFBFBD><EFBFBD>ж<EFBFBD>Դ
|
|
|
|
|
26 2 AfeWDTDis(); //<2F>ر<EFBFBD>AFE<46>Ŀ<EFBFBD><C4BF>Ź<EFBFBD><C5B9><EFBFBD><EFBFBD>ܣ<EFBFBD><DCA3><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ڸ<EFBFBD><DAB8>³<EFBFBD><C2B3><EFBFBD>ʱMCU<43>Ḵλ
|
|
|
|
|
27 2 ((void(code*)(void))0x00A6)(); //Boot<6F><74><EFBFBD><EFBFBD>IAP<41><50>ISP<53><50><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
|
|
|
|
|
28 2 }
|
|
|
|
|
29 1 }
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
MODULE INFORMATION: STATIC OVERLAYABLE
|
|
|
|
|
CODE SIZE = 29 ----
|
|
|
|
|
CONSTANT SIZE = ---- ----
|
|
|
|
|
XDATA SIZE = ---- ----
|
|
|
|
|
PDATA SIZE = ---- ----
|
|
|
|
|
DATA SIZE = ---- ----
|
|
|
|
|
IDATA SIZE = ---- ----
|
|
|
|
|
BIT SIZE = ---- ----
|
|
|
|
|
END OF MODULE INFORMATION.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
C51 COMPILATION COMPLETE. 0 WARNING(S), 0 ERROR(S)
|